Over a dozen annual reports of the National Commissions for Scheduled Castes (NCSC), Scheduled Tribes (NCST), and Other Backward Classes (NCBC) have not been made public for up to seven years. This delay impacts transparency and the timely implementation of welfare measures meant for marginalized communities. Summary: NCSC and NCST have not submitted annual reports for the past two years; NCBC has not done so for three years. The Defence Research and Development Organisation (DRDO) has successfully conducted a long-duration ground test of an Active Cooled Scramjet Subscale Combustor for over 1,000 seconds, marking a pivotal step in India’s hypersonic cruise missile development. This breakthrough positions India among a select group of nations advancing rapidly in next-generation missile systems. Summary DRDO successfully tested a scramjet combustor for 1,000 seconds, a significant leap from the 120-second test in January 2025. India and France are set to finalize a ₹63,000-crore government-to-government (G-to-G) deal for 26 Rafale-M (Marine) fighter jets on April 28, 2025. This deal significantly boosts India’s naval aviation capability and builds upon the earlier Indo-French defence cooperation established with the IAF Rafale deal in 2016. Summary Deal Value: ₹63,000 crore for 26 Rafale-M fighter jets. Signatories: Indian Defence Minister Rajnath Singh and French Defence Minister Sebastien Lecornu (remotely). The Union Government has informed the Supreme Court that extensive misuse of waqf provisions led to unprecedented encroachments on private and government properties, necessitating significant amendments to the Waqf Act in 2025. The misuse led to a shocking 116% increase in waqf land holdings in just 11 years, post-2013 amendments, a figure unmatched even in historical eras such as the Mughal period.
